Finally, it took a global pandemic to shake up the cycling calendar. For many years, a growing movement has criticised the structure of the sport - its business model and its calendar. The coronavirus crisis has done nothing to help with the former, but it has impelled the sports’ stakeholders to bodge together a calendar that owes everything to necessity and very little to coherence, logic or narrative.
Of course, the 2020 race calendar is an emergency one, and the biggest caveat of all is that it could collapse completely if covid-19 flares up again. This is less a model for alternatives than cycling recognising that it simply doesn’t matter what form the racing is better than no racing.
